Просмотр исходного кода

Fix for issue #9005, #8942 - Bed PID autotuning (#9036)

revilor 7 лет назад
Родитель
Сommit
0e93506985
1 измененных файлов: 2 добавлений и 2 удалений
  1. 2
    2
      Marlin/src/module/temperature.cpp

+ 2
- 2
Marlin/src/module/temperature.cpp Просмотреть файл

@@ -242,8 +242,8 @@ uint8_t Temperature::soft_pwm_amount[HOTENDS],
242 242
     #endif
243 243
 
244 244
     #if WATCH_THE_BED || WATCH_HOTENDS
245
-      const int8_t watch_temp_period = TV(WATCH_BED_TEMP_PERIOD, WATCH_TEMP_PERIOD),
246
-                   watch_temp_increase = TV(WATCH_BED_TEMP_INCREASE, WATCH_TEMP_INCREASE);
245
+      const uint16_t watch_temp_period = TV(WATCH_BED_TEMP_PERIOD, WATCH_TEMP_PERIOD);
246
+      const uint8_t watch_temp_increase = TV(WATCH_BED_TEMP_INCREASE, WATCH_TEMP_INCREASE);
247 247
       const float watch_temp_target = target - float(watch_temp_increase + TV(TEMP_BED_HYSTERESIS, TEMP_HYSTERESIS) + 1);
248 248
       millis_t temp_change_ms = next_temp_ms + watch_temp_period * 1000UL;
249 249
       float next_watch_temp = 0.0;

Загрузка…
Отмена
Сохранить